Intertitle reads: "Vienna".
Vienna Police demonstrate with smoke bombs, Austria. Various shots of military exercise in rural setting. The police are armed with machine guns, throw smoke bombs and drive tanks - narrator suggests they are "preparing for something".
Intertitle reads: "Lille".
French Cabinet Minister's funeral, France. Funeral of Minister of the Interior, Roger Salangro (sp.?), who committed suicide. As leader of French Popular Front Party he was the victim of false allegations. French Prime Minister M. Blum walks behind hearse. Large crowds watch. Very sombre atmosphere.
Intertitle reads: "Woking".
Digging up Christmas trees at Woking, Surrey and Christmas turkeys. Various shots of men chopping down Christmas trees and loading them onto a horse drawn cart. Various shots of large herd of turkeys running around farm yard.
Intertitle reads: "Angers".
Angers ravaged by serious fire, France. Various shots of burnt out buildings and piles of debris. A fire started in market and went on to destroy 50 houses. Looks like a "war zone".
Intertitle reads: "Carrara".
Million ton blast at Carrara, Italy. Various shots of men laying dynamite in Tuscany mountain side. The explosion will blast out a large block of marble.
Intertitle reads: "Luray, Ohio".
Corn husking competition in United States of America (USA). Various shots of men racing to husk the most corn on the cobs. Competition takes place in corn field, a mobile radio cart broadcasts live from the event. C/U of winner - Karl Carson.
Intertitle reads: "Charlton, near Evesham".
Brussel Sprout picking competition near Evesham, Hereford and Worcester. Various shots of men and women racing to pick most sprouts.
Intertitle reads: "Berlin".
Training Drum Majors in Berlin, Germany. Various shots of soldiers of German army in training on parade ground. The soldiers - drum major cadets - practice twirling their batons to sound of military band.
